TeacherActive is seeking a dedicated Maths Teacher for a position in Bruton, Somerset. The teacher will deliver engaging and differentiated lessons across KS3 and KS4, support student progress, and foster a positive attitude towards Mathematics. This is a permanent position with opportunities for professional development in a strong, collaborative staff community that values student outcomes.

How to prepare for a job interview at TeacherActive
✨Know Your Curriculum
Make sure you’re well-versed in the KS3 and KS4 Maths curriculum. Familiarise yourself with the key topics and how to differentiate lessons for various learning styles. This will show your potential employer that you’re prepared to engage all students effectively.
✨Showcase Your Teaching Style
Prepare to discuss your teaching philosophy and methods. Bring examples of lesson plans or activities that have worked well in the past. This gives the interviewers a clear picture of how you can contribute to their collaborative staff community.
✨Highlight Student Progress Strategies
Be ready to talk about how you support student progress. Share specific strategies you’ve used to help students overcome challenges in Maths. This demonstrates your commitment to fostering a positive attitude towards the subject.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the school’s approach to professional development and collaboration among staff. This shows your interest in growing within the role and your desire to be part of a supportive community.
